Edmonton, A.B. - The Art Gallery of Alberta is proud to present GENERATION, on display from January 19-March 24, 2008. GENERATION features nine contemporary artists from Canada and the United States whose work incorporates the images, ideas, and anxieties of North American youth. This exhibition is a fresh look at the experience of youth in the 21st century, the life that is created for them and the life they create for themselves.
Over the course of the last century teen culture has become the pre-dominant focus of popular culture and in recent years, teenagers have become an incredible force within all areas of society. GENERATION addresses issues of today’s youth through installation, painting, photography, and film.
Five of the artists in GENERATION will be speaking about their work during HSBC All Day Saturday on January 19 at 2:00 pm. Related programming for this event includes Daniel Barrow’s Winnipeg Babysitter (January 16 at Metro Cinema), Imagining WoW, an en-masse gaming event (February 9), and Mind the Gap: A Think Tank on the Culture of Youth (March 15). This exhibition is curated by Catherine Crowston, Chieft Curator and Deputy Director for the Art Gallery of Alberta.
